WebJan 2, 2024 · Army PRT is guided by three principles of readiness training: Precision: ensures all PRT activities are executed using proper technique to reduce injury risk. Progression: gradually increases the intensity and duration of PRT activities to allow the body to properly adapt to the stresses of training. WebFORT EUSTIS, VA, February 23, 2024 - The Holistic Health and Fitness initiative, created by U.S. Army Training and Doctrine Command’s Center for Initial Military Training, focuses on a new approach to training Soldiers. H2F follows five domains of readiness: mental, spiritual, physical, nutritional, and sleep. WebJun 12, 2024 · On 12 June 2024, the HRC Commanding General approved the Personnel Readiness Summary (PRS) Guide as a replacement to the Human Resources Metrics Guide for Commanders, dated 8 March 2013. Input from HR professionals in the field was gathered by the HR Metrics Working Group over a period of six months.
